What Is Cortisol?
Cortisol is not a "villain"—it is one of your body's most essential survival hormones, produced by the adrenal glands to manage vital daily operations:
- Morning Drive: Generates the natural alertness needed to wake up energized.
- Metabolic Control: Regulates blood pressure and balances blood glucose levels.
- Systemic Protection: Controls cellular inflammation and mobilizes rapid energy during challenges.
In a healthy system, cortisol follows a strict circadian rhythm. It peaks around 8:00 AM to power your morning and gradually falls to its lowest level late in the evening, allowing melatonin (your sleep hormone) to initiate deep recovery.
The problem is never cortisol itself. The issue begins when modern routines keep the body under perpetual threat, preventing the nervous system from switching the stress response off.
The HPA Axis: Stuck in Survival Mode
When your brain perceives a threat—whether it is an oncoming vehicle or a high-pressure work deadline—it activates the Hypothalamic-Pituitary-Adrenal (HPA) Axis. Within moments:
- Hormones Cascade: Signals travel to the adrenal glands, flooding cortisol into the bloodstream.
- Energy Mobilizes: Heart rate and blood sugar rise to prepare your muscles and brain for immediate action.
- Resources Shift: Digestion, immunity, tissue repair, and other long-term maintenance functions are temporarily reduced so survival becomes the body's priority.
While highly effective during short-term emergencies, the brain treats modern stressors—deadlines, financial worries, relationship conflicts, and endless notifications—in exactly the same way. When these persist for months or years, the body remains trapped in a prolonged state of hyper-alertness.
The Chronic Stress–Sleep Cycle
Sustained stress gradually disrupts healthy sleep architecture. When evening cortisol fails to decline, it creates a destructive biological cycle:
- You wake up feeling tired and unrefreshed.
- Fatigue increases reliance on caffeine and sugary foods.
- Blood sugar fluctuations and digestive irritation create additional stress.
- The autonomic nervous system remains trapped in a cycle of exhaustion and heightened alertness.
Breaking this cycle requires small, consistent habits that repeatedly communicate safety back to the nervous system.
The "Cortisol Belly" Reality
Abdominal fat is not a storehouse of literal "cortisol waste." Instead, it is a visible sign that your body is adapting to prolonged physiological stress.
Although genetics, age, and nutrition strongly influence body composition, chronic cortisol elevation shifts fat storage toward the abdomen through several biological pathways:
- Visceral Fat Targeting: Deep abdominal fat (visceral fat) contains a high density of glucocorticoid receptors, making it especially responsive to circulating cortisol.
- Altered Energy Balance: Prolonged stress disrupts insulin regulation, increases cravings for calorie-dense foods, and promotes fat storage around vital organs such as the liver and intestines, increasing long-term metabolic risk.

3. Understanding Stress Physiology & Energy Balance
- Glucocorticoid Sensitivity: Scientific research shows that visceral fat cells are highly responsive to glucocorticoids like cortisol. When cortisol remains elevated, the body prioritizes storing energy in these deep abdominal fat reserves rather than utilizing them for daily fuel.
- The Sleep Connection: Sleep deprivation significantly alters stress physiology. Poor sleep disrupts the natural daily rhythm of cortisol, preventing the hormone from dropping appropriately in the evening and encouraging continued fat storage.
- Hormonal Interplay: Cortisol helps mobilize energy during perceived threats. However, when stress is chronic and physical activity is low, this hormonal shift contributes to blood sugar fluctuations and insulin imbalance, promoting long-term fat storage.
- Nervous System Autonomy: When your body remains stuck in a sympathetic ("fight-or-flight") state, it struggles to access the parasympathetic ("rest-and-digest") state required for proper digestion, tissue repair, deep sleep, and cellular recovery.
4. Everyday Stress Accumulators (Root Cause Checklist)
Most individuals assume physiological stress stems entirely from major psychological events. In reality, modern daily routines act as chronic physical accumulators, systematically keeping the autonomic nervous system locked in survival mode.
Review this clinical checklist of the eight primary modern stressors to identify which baseline behaviours may be driving your body's stress response.
⚠️ Stressor
✅ Modality Reset
1. Reactive Mornings (Digital Overload)
Reaching for your smartphone within the first 30 minutes of waking floods your brain with emails, notifications, and work messages. Before leaving bed, your brain is pushed into high-alert problem-solving mode, causing an immediate drop in morning calm.
🌿 Naturopathic Hygiene
Dedicate the first 15–30 minutes of your day to screen-free grounding. Open your curtains, expose your eyes to natural daylight, drink a glass of water, and allow your nervous system to establish a natural waking rhythm.
2. Living on Caffeine (Masked Fatigue)
Using caffeine as a substitute for genuine recovery masks fatigue. Multiple coffees or energy drinks leave stimulants circulating for several hours, delaying sleep onset and hiding signs of systemic exhaustion.
☕ Metabolic Optimisation
Implement strict caffeine boundaries. Avoid stimulants immediately after waking and after 2:00 PM. If you rely on caffeine simply to function, consider it a sign of poor sleep quality rather than a lack of coffee.
3. Prolonged Physical Stagnation (Sitting Stress)
Spending most of the day sitting in a fixed position contributes to muscle stiffness, neck and shoulder tension, reduced circulation, and shallow breathing.
🚶 Movement Therapy
Prioritise movement frequency over exercise intensity. Stand or walk every 60–90 minutes, and follow the 20-20-20 rule: every 20 minutes, look at a distant object for 20 seconds.
4. Chronic Shallow Breathing (Upper Chest Restriction)
During periods of mental stress many people unconsciously switch to rapid, shallow chest breathing. This signals to the brain that danger is present, increasing muscle tension and anxiety.
🫁 Neural Regulation
Perform a one-minute diaphragmatic breathing reset several times each day. Breathe gently through your nose, allowing the abdomen to expand before exhaling slowly and completely.
5. Irregular Eating Patterns (Digestive Distress)
Skipping meals or eating heavy dinners late at night disrupts metabolic stability. Late-night digestion keeps the digestive system active during the body's natural recovery period, reducing sleep quality.
🥗 Circadian Nutrition
Focus on meal consistency rather than perfection. Eat balanced meals at regular times each day and finish your final large meal at least 2–3 hours before bedtime.
6. Constant Digital Stimulation (Notification Fatigue)
Constant exposure to notifications, streaming media, messaging platforms, and social media repeatedly interrupts attention and prevents the brain from entering genuine recovery periods.
📵 Digital Boundary Work
Turn off non-essential notifications, avoid work communication after a fixed evening hour, and keep digital devices outside the bedroom whenever possible.
7. Neglecting Natural Light (Circadian Mismatch)
Spending the day indoors under artificial lighting while using bright screens late into the evening disrupts your body's biological clock and affects sleep, mood, and hormonal balance.
☀️ Biophoton Regulation
Spend at least 15–20 minutes outdoors in natural morning sunlight. Morning light helps regulate circadian rhythms and supports healthy evening melatonin production.
8. The Chronic Action Trap (Absence of Restoration)
Living in a continuous cycle of working, planning, cleaning, scrolling, or consuming media without intentional periods of stillness leaves no space for genuine mental recovery.
🧘 Mind-Body Mastery
Redefine recovery. Rest is not simply the absence of work—it requires intentional restoration. Spend a few minutes every day doing absolutely nothing and allow your mind and body to fully unwind.

6. The 3-Step Bedtime Reset Routine
Step 1: Sound-Frequency Grounding (Naturopathic Support)
The Protocol: Before getting into bed, switch off all digital screens. Spend five minutes listening to a low-frequency ambient soundscape or a structured sound bath at a comfortable volume.
Why it Works: Gentle sound stimulation may help reduce mental overactivity by encouraging the brain to transition away from a high-alert state and prepare for rest.
Step 2: The 4-7-8 Somatic Release (Neural Regulation)
The Protocol:
- Inhale quietly through your nose for 4 seconds.
- Hold your breath for 7 seconds.
- Exhale slowly through your mouth for 8 seconds while making a gentle "whoosh" sound.
- Repeat the sequence four times.
Why it Works: Slow, rhythmic breathing supports relaxation, improves vagal tone, and helps encourage the body's transition into a calmer physiological state before sleep.
Step 3: Three Minutes of Deep Inversion (Neurotherapy Habit)
The Protocol:
- Lie flat on your back on a firm surface or yoga mat.
- Extend your legs vertically against a wall so your body forms an L-shape.
- Relax your arms beside you with your palms facing upward.
- Close your eyes and remain in this position for 3 to 5 minutes while breathing comfortably.
Why it Works: This gentle inversion encourages venous return, influences cardiovascular signalling, and may help reduce nervous system arousal, allowing the body to transition more easily into rest and recovery.
